Terms Used In Louisiana Civil Code 781

  • Damages: Money paid by defendants to successful plaintiffs in civil cases to compensate the plaintiffs for their injuries.
  • Injunction: An order of the court prohibiting (or compelling) the performance of a specific act to prevent irreparable damage or injury.

No action for injunction or for damages on account of the violation of a building restriction may be brought after two years from the commencement of a noticeable violation.  After the lapse of this period, the immovable on which the violation occurred is freed of the restriction that has been violated.
